Design.com
AI logo generator with a brand-reasoning layer that explains its creative decisions.
Pros
- +Generates initial design concepts from simple user input
- +Covers logos and broader branded marketing materials together
- +Affordable option for entrepreneurs building a brand identity
Cons
- –Generated designs may need further customization for uniqueness
- –Less design depth than working with a professional designer
Mock It Ai
AI moodboard generator for fast concept exploration and visual direction.
Pros
- +Generates realistic mockups without manual compositing work
- +Useful for professionally showcasing design work in context
- +Saves time compared to manually creating mockup scenes
Cons
- –Mockup scene variety may be limited compared to manual stock options
- –Best suited for standard presentation contexts rather than highly custom scenes
